Wilhelm Dürrschmidt
August Wilhelm Dürrschmidt, the son of maker Heinrich Georg Dürrschmidt, was born in 1863 in Markneukirchen. He took up his father’s trade and founded the Wilhelm Dürrschmidt company in 1887, which specialized in the making of bowed and stringed instruments. Their instruments became highly sought after in the United States. The firm continued making instruments after Wilhelm Dürrschmidt’s death in 1937.
